Summer School on Artificial Intelligence and Cybersecurity
The first Summer School on AI and Cybersecurity will take place from 22 to 26 September 2025 at TU Wien. This premier, week-long event stands at the intersection of cutting-edge research and practical application, bringing together leading experts, researchers, and students from around the world to explore the transformative impact of artificial intelligence on modern cybersecurity.
Participants will dive into key topics such as explainable AI, threat detection, adversarial machine learning, and secure system design through a dynamic mix of hands-on workshops, inspiring lectures, and collaborative projects.
